Responsibilities :
Responsible for assessing, planning, organizing, administering, documenting and evaluating direct physical therapy patient care in accordance with accepted physical therapy practice and the physician's overall treatment plan.
Establishes and maintains involvement in treatment plans carried out by PTAs.
Performs a thorough and complete evaluation of patients properly referred according to Florida law in order to determine the patient's rehab potential and establish an individually based treatment plan.
Administers physical therapy treatments to patients according to professional standards and department standard operating procedure in order to maximize the patient's potential functioning level and to achieve treatment goals.
Maintains and completes accurate documentation, department records and reports for all assigned patients in order to provide a clear record and to communicate patient's treatment plan and progress to the referring physician.
Oversight of 2 Physical Therapy Assistants
Requirements :
Graduate of an accredited school of Physical Therapy (APTA) required or DPT.
Must have current PT license in the State of Florida
Must possess interpersonal skills sufficient to interact effectively with patients coping with pain in order to gain their cooperation and maximize improvement.
Must be able to provide effective instruction to patients and family members.

Depending on the type and severity of the patient's injury(s) some of the practices that may be employed in your rehabilitation plan may include :
- Postural Re-alignment Techniques
- Muscle Energy Techniques(Neuromuscular Re-education)
- Trigger Point Releases
- Stretching Exercises
- Therapeutic Exercises
- Lumbar / Cervical Traction
- Ice / Heat Therapy
- Electrical Muscle Stimulation
- Specialized Rehabilitation Treatment Programs for Scoliosis (Pediatric and Adults)
- Specialized Post-Trauma Therapy Treatments Protocols each Designed for Specific Injuries
